Understanding Pose and Neck Discomfort
When it comes to neck discomfort, understanding the role of posture is crucial. Your stance considerably affects the positioning of your back and the total health and wellness of your neck. When you sit or stand correctly, your body keeps an all-natural curve, which can protect against unneeded pressure on your neck muscles.
You mightn't understand it, yet just how you place your head, shoulders, and back can either ease or worsen discomfort. When you're hunched over a computer or overlooking at your phone, you're likely putting excessive stress on your neck. This forward head posture can cause muscle tension and discomfort.
You need to be conscious of just how your body aligns throughout the day and make changes as necessary. Easy methods can help enhance your position. For instance, ensure your workstation is ergonomically established, enabling your display to be at eye degree.
When you're resting, attempt to keep your feet flat on the ground and your back straight. Regularly sign in with your posture and make small adjustments to avoid long-lasting pain. By prioritizing excellent pose, you can considerably minimize your danger of neck pain and maintain a more comfy, healthy lifestyle.
Common Position Mistakes
Lots of people unwittingly make common position mistakes that can bring about neck pain and pain. Among one of the most constant mistakes is slouching while sitting or standing. When you hunch your shoulders or lean forward, you stress your neck muscles, creating stress that can rise into pain.
Another mistake is overlooking at your gadgets for extensive periods. Whether you're scrolling on your phone or working at a computer, turning your head downward puts extra stress on your neck.
Additionally, you could find yourself craning your neck to get a better view, specifically in jampacked areas or throughout conferences. This forward head posture can add to chronic neck pain in time.

Chiropractic Care Tips for Improvement
Improving your posture and decreasing neck discomfort can be dramatically helped by chiropractic care. Routine check outs to a chiropractic doctor can assist realign your spine, which typically eases tension in the neck. They'll assess your pose and offer tailored changes that advertise better positioning.
You should also incorporate particular exercises right into your routine. Reinforcing your neck and upper back muscles can improve your position. Basic workouts like chin tucks and shoulder blade squeezes can make a big difference.
Furthermore, stretching your neck and top back can relieve rigidity that adds to discomfort.
Focus on your work area. Guarantee your computer system screen is at eye level, and your chair sustains your lower back. When sitting, maintain your feet level on the flooring and your shoulders loosened up.
Last but not least, bear in mind your habits. If you spend a great deal of time on your phone, hold it at eye degree rather than flexing your neck down.
